Precise definition
Categorical data record group membership; nominal categories have no intrinsic order, while ordinal categories do. Quantitative data record numerical magnitude; discrete variables take countable values and continuous variables can vary over intervals within measurement precision.
Notation and mathematical language
Interval scales have meaningful differences but no meaningful absolute zero, while ratio scales support meaningful ratios because zero represents absence of the quantity. These labels guide permissible summaries, but subject-matter meaning matters more than storage type.
Conceptual picture
Numbers can be labels, ranks, counts, or measurements. The operation must preserve meaning: a median can summarize ordered categories, while a mean of arbitrary nominal codes cannot. Continuous measurements are stored discretely after rounding but remain conceptually continuous.

Interpretation and application
Correct type classification prevents meaningless averages, inappropriate charts, and invalid models in surveys, experiments, and databases. It does not by itself address bias, dependence, or causation.
